How long does Xylan coating last?

How long does Xylan coating last?

Xylan 1424 is a fastener coating used to prevent corrosion and improve make up torque. When applied over zinc phosphate it can withstand 1,500 hours of salt fog. This can be extended even longer if it is applied over a primer such as Xylar 1.

What is the purpose of Xylan coating?

Xylan coatings provide lubrication and controlled friction, wear resistance, heat resistance, non-stick and release properties. At the same time they also protect from corrosion. They are extreme performance coatings – working under heavy loads, at high temperatures, in chemical and corrosive environments.

Is Xylan a PTFE?

Xylan is an industrial dry film lubricant consisting primarily of one or more fluoropolymers including polytetrafluoroethylene (PTFE) (Figure 1), perfluoroalkoxy alkane (PFA) and fluorinated ethylene propylene (FEP).

What is Xylan coating made of?

Xylan coatings are made from wear-resistant composites of fluoropolymers such as PTFE (Polytetrafluoroethylene), PFA (Perfluoroalkoxy alkane), and FEP (Fluorinated ethylene propylene), along with reinforcing binder resins. They can be used in environments with temperatures up to and over 550 F.

What is the blue coating on bolts?

Xylan
Teflon Blue B7 Stud Bolts
B7 blue studs are often referred to this way due to their blue color. These B7 blue studs have been treated with a baked-on coating called Xylan or Teflon coating. This process takes a stud bolt that is plain and bakes on a special coating resulting in Teflon B7 blue studs.

What is Xylan made of?

The xylan polymer is composed of a repeating β1,4 xylose residue backbone, a reducing end sequence (RES) of xylose, rhamnose and galacturonic acid and is highly modified with acetyl and (methyl)glucuronic acid side groups (Scheller and Ulvskov, 2010; Pauly et al., 2013; Rennie and Scheller, 2014).

Is blue Loctite removable?

LOCTITE® blue threadlocker is medium strength threadlocker adhesive. This product cures fully in 24 hours and can be disassembled with hand tools. Blue threadlockers are removable with standard hand tools on 6mm to 20mm fasteners, have fast fixture times, and are available in liquid, stick, paste and gel form.

How do I get rid of blue threadlocker?

Removing threadlocker varies depending on the type you’re working with. For Loctite threadlocker blue, simply remove the bolt and nut with normal tools. Loctite Threadlocker Red 271, is formulated to be a high strength thread locker, meaning it will require the localized heat of a blowtorch to weaken the bond.

Where is xylan found?

The substrate of xylanases, xylan, is a major structural polysaccharide in plant cells. It is found in the cell walls of land plants, in which they may constitute more than 30% of the dry weight.
